Reviews

Snapmaker Luban

Snapmaker Luban is a specialized 3D printing software tailored for Snapmaker machines, offering a comprehensive suite for design, slicing, and printing. It's ideal for 3D printing enthusiasts and professionals looking for a streamlined workflow.

Design, slice, and print 3D models specifically for Snapmaker devices.

Pros

  • + Tailored for Snapmaker devices, ensuring optimal performance.
  • + Comprehensive 3-in-1 software covering design, slicing, and printing.
  • + Auto-updates keep the software current and secure.

Cons

  • - High number of open issues may indicate potential bugs or pending improvements.
  • - Compatibility issues with certain tools, such as Inkscape, have been reported.

Snapmaker Orca

Snapmaker Orca is a slicing software tailored for Snapmaker 3D printers, offering support for various printer types. It's a fork of OrcaSlicer, designed for users needing precise G-code generation for their 3D printing projects.

Converts 3D models into G-code for compatible 3D printers.

Pros

  • + Supports multiple 3D printer types
  • + Regular updates and active development
  • + Open-source under AGPL-3.0 license

Cons

  • - Some reported bugs and UI issues
  • - Limited community presence outside GitHub
